Latest obligation under the 2018 Los Alamos National Laboratory management and operations contract, extending through 2028.
Los Alamos is critical to U.S. nuclear weapons stewardship, stockpile maintenance, and advanced energy research; this multi-billion-dollar M&O contract ensures continuity of national security operations.
Triad (Lockheed Martin, Battelle, University of California joint venture) manages procurement and subcontracting for one of the nation's largest federal R&D facilities, affecting thousands of suppliers across defense, energy, and advanced manufacturing.
Los Alamos conducts classified nuclear weapons research and advanced computing critical to maintaining U.S. strategic deterrent superiority amid rising China competition.
